Warning Signs You Need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air

Water damage on your hardwood floors can be a ticking time bomb, waiting to unleash a world of problems if left unchecked. Don’t wait until it’s too late, here are some warning signs that you need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

That unmistakable smell of dampness and decay is a clear indication that your hardwood floors are suffering from water damage. Don’t ignore it, call us today to schedule a consultation.

Discoloration and Warping

Water damage can cause your hardwood floors to discolor, warp, or buckle. If you notice any of these symptoms, it’s time to act fast.

Swollen or Bubbled Wood

Water can cause the wood to swell or bubble, leading to uneven surfaces and a host of other problems. Don’t wait until it’s too late, call us today.

Soft or Spongy Wood

Water damage can cause the wood to become soft or spongy to the touch. If you notice this symptom, it’s time to call in the experts.

Visible Water Stains

Water stains on your hardwood floors are a clear indication that you need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air. Don’t ignore them, call us today.

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water spill (less than 1 gallon) Yes No DIY cleanup is usually enough for small spills.
Large water spill (over 1 gallon) No Yes Large spills need specialized equipment and expertise to prevent further damage.
Visible water stains or discoloration No Yes Water stains and discoloration show underlying water damage that needs professional attention.
Swollen or bubbled wood No Yes Swollen or bubbled wood is a sign of advanced water damage that needs professional restoration.
Soft or spongy wood No Yes Soft or spongy wood is a sign of advanced water damage that needs professional attention.
Water damage in a high-traffic area No Yes High-traffic areas need specialized attention to prevent further damage and ensure safety.

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air Cost in Camden, NC

The cost of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air in Camden, NC will v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for different aspects of the service: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Assessment and Containment $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ions.
Drying and Extraction $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ment used, and duration of drying process.
Cleaning and Disinfecting $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of cleaning solution used, and level of disinfection required.
Restoration and Finishing $2,000 – $10,000 Size of affected area, type of finish used, and level of restoration required.
Specialized Equipment Rental $500 – $2,000 Duration of rental, type of equipment rented, and local conditions.

Common Questions About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air

Will my insurance cover the cost of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air?

Yes, most insurance policies cover water damage to hardwood floors. But, the specifics will depend on your policy and the circumstances surrounding the damage. We’ll work with your insurance company to ensure a smooth claims process.

How long will it take to complete the repair?

The duration of the repair will depend on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the level of restoration required. Typically, the process takes anywhere from 3-5 days, but in some cases, it may take longer.

Will I need to replace my hardwood floors?

Not necessarily. In many cases, we can restore your hardwood floors to their original beauty using specialized equipment and techniques. But, if the damage is extensive or the floors are beyond repair, replacement may be necessary.
